Output 1929faa3f1553206de1dfdc96e0cc024a301dc01c876d05a705d7b0ec798e6f4:12

value
953212
script pubkey
OP_0 OP_PUSHBYTES_20 87ebe3c1a7ae406dd5c0607093cb3799bc11b264
address
bc1qsl478sd84eqxm4wqvpcf8jehnx7prvny0k29wf
transaction
1929faa3f1553206de1dfdc96e0cc024a301dc01c876d05a705d7b0ec798e6f4
confirmations
174276
spent
true